MARA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review

362 of the 7,596 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Marathon Digital Holdings (MARA)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$3.5B — up 49% from $2.35B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 65 funds opened new MARA positions and 48 closed out — a net gain of 17 holders — while 155 added to existing stakes and 93 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Marex Group, adding an estimated $70M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$40M.
